Transaction ec7b8454a6a99717753009df182059f36edb0ea35697682651e122066975d025
1 Input
1 Output
-
ec7b8454a6a99717753009df182059f36edb0ea35697682651e122066975d025:0
- value
- 213215
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f4221196aa7acda586115f44bd09904fcc09cbca OP_EQUAL
- address
- 3PwscV7XJvuoYCS6WDUuxHqWcxoqM7TNAi